Sandwich panel walls are a popular choice for both residential and commercial construction projects. These panels consist of a core material sandwiched between two facings. Common core materials include polyurethane foam, expanded polystyrene (EPS), and mineral wool. The facings can be made from materials such as steel, aluminum, wood, or composite boards. These panel walls offer excellent insulation, making them ideal for reducing heating and cooling costs. They are lightweight, making them easier to handle and install. Additionally, they are highly resistant to moisture, making them perfect for humid environments.

Before installing the sandwich panels, it's essential to prepare the site: 1. Fixing Imperfections: Adjust any uneven surfaces to ensure a flat base. 2. Cleaning the Area: Remove any dust, debris, or imperfections from the walls. 3. Marking the Area: Use a level and measuring tape to mark where each panel will go. Proper preparation will ensure that the installation process runs smoothly and that the final result is precise and professional.
Here are the steps to install the sandwich panels: 1. Attach the Panels: Use a level to ensure the panels are perfectly aligned. Secure them using screws and washers. 2. Handle Safely: Use gloves to handle the panels and move them in groups to avoid damaging the core material. 3. Check Alignment: Use a level to check the alignment and adjust as necessary. Proper attachment and handling techniques will ensure that the panels are installed correctly and securely.
After installation, sealing the joints and gaps between panels is crucial: 1. Seal Gaps: Use a sealant to fill any gaps between the panels. 2. Achieve a Professional Look: Apply the sealant evenly to create a smooth, seamless finish. Sealing the joints not only enhances insulation but also prevents air leaks and reduces the risk of moisture and pests entering.
During installation, you may encounter some common issues: 1. Uneven Surfaces: Adjust the panels as needed to ensure they are flush. 2. Gaps: Use additional sealant to fill any gaps. 3. Misalignments: Remove any screws and reposition the panels to ensure they are aligned. Addressing these issues will result in a high-quality installation.
To maintain the integrity and longevity of your sandwich panel walls, follow these tips: 1. Regular Cleaning: Clean the walls periodically to remove dust and debris. 2. Check for Damage: Conduct regular inspections to identify any wear or damage. 3. Protect from Elements: Use waterproofing agents and UV-resistant sealants to enhance durability. Proper maintenance will ensure that your sandwich panel walls remain effective and attractive for years to come.

When compared to other wall materials like drywall or brick, sandwich panels offer several advantages: - Lightweight and Easy to Handle: Unlike heavier materials, sandwich panels are easier to manage. - Superior Insulation: They provide excellent insulation, reducing heating and cooling costs. - Resistance to Moisture: They are highly resistant to moisture, making them suitable for humid environments. While other materials may offer different benefits, sandwich panels excel in insulation and ease of installation.
